__doc__="""Implement Observable interface (see
http://www.zope.org/Members/michel/Projects/Interfaces/ObserverAndNotification)
This class is intended to be used as a mixin (note that it doesn't derive
from any Zope persistence classes, for instance).
$Id: DefaultObservable.py,v 1.1 2000/06/09 16:46:37 tseaver Exp $"""
__version__='$Revision: 1.1 $'[11:-2]
import string
from types import StringType
class DefaultObservable:
def __init__( self, debug=0 ):
self._observers = []
self._debug = debug
def _normalize( self, observer ):
# Assert that observer is a string or a sequence of strings.
if type( observer ) != StringType:
observer = string.join( observer, '/' )
return observer
#
# Observable interface methods.
#
def registerObserver( self, observer ):
normal = self._normalize( observer )
if self.restrictedTraverse( normal, None ):
self._observers.append( normal )
else:
raise NameError, observer
def unregisterObserver( self, observer ):
self._observers.remove( self._normalize( observer ) )
#
# Convenience method for derivatives.
#
def notify( self, event=None ):
bozos = []
for observer in self._observers:
obj = self.restrictedTraverse( observer, None )
if obj is not None:
try:
obj( self, event )
except:
bozos.append( observer ) # Veto not allowed!
if self._debug:
import traceback
traceback.print_exc()
else:
bozos.append( observer )
for bozo in bozos:
self._observers.remove( bozo )
